WebLITHIUM METAL BATTERIES Section IA Acceptable to dangerous goods locations where UN3090 is not prohibited. 1 Cells greater than 1g and Batteries greater than 2g • Shipper’s Declaration required in net weight KG. • UN number, proper shipping name and shipper/ consignee name and address on the package • UN specification packaging required ...
